Output 89918137866ac92b86e031d2c642e46f10392f9d85fd35a02765a88c52f84a89:1

value
3997748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0079abef65e377106ce6451f9a35899a38a44a5b OP_EQUAL
address
31jXgSFkDk8RiR3FYSzVxzBswkTUX6f41r
transaction
89918137866ac92b86e031d2c642e46f10392f9d85fd35a02765a88c52f84a89
spent
true